Teams that could use him.

:leafs:isles:edmonton:wings:vegas:devils

Why would he not sign in NJ? So the Islanders. Detroit, Edmonton make zero sense.

Islanders if they sign JT wont have the space, if they dont sign JT will not be desireable - esp if NJ is same thing geographically with much better trajectory.

Edmonton - No reason to to go western canada for that.

Detroit. Just dont see anything compelling about that situation when others will offer same $.

Toronto may have a hard time matching $ - but players always seem to be attracted there so can't discount it.

Vegas it seems is developing into a unique place so can't discount that either but its a western city for a guy from NJ who has played East, his family and wife family all from east. Why?

NJ - He's from NJ, grew up going to Devils games, when the Caps play in Newark he has a group of 100+ in stands. The Devils are in desperate need of a 1D. They are a playoff team with YOUTH and on the rise. Have a MVP or near MVP in his prime returning, Hischier at 19 (next year) a very good core rising. A great arena situation (one of only 2 in NHL with practice rink attached to game rink - go to same office everyday - Hall has spoken glowingly about this)... Great suburbs for family life. PLUS - they have all the cap in the world...

Again - why not?
